Ir para conteúdo
  • Cadastre-se

dev botao

Erro a instalar atualização - ACBrDFeHttpIndy.pas


Ver Solução Respondido por BigWings,
  • Este tópico foi criado há 2025 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Postado

Olá a todos,

 

Foi efetuar a atualização hoje do ACBr e está gerando esse erro ao tentar instalar.

Abaixo está o trecho do código que gera o erro.

 

Embarcadero Delphi for Win32 compiler version 33.0
Copyright (c) 1983,2018 Embarcadero Technologies, Inc.
D:\ACBr\Fontes\ACBrDFe\ACBrDFeHttpIndy.pas(150) Error: E2029 Statement expected but '<' found
D:\ACBr\Fontes\ACBrDFe\ACBrDFeHttpIndy.pas(152) Error: E2029 ':=' expected but '=' found
D:\ACBr\Fontes\ACBrDFe\ACBrDFeSSL.pas(2618) Fatal: F2063 Could not compile used unit 'ACBrDFeHttpIndy.pas'
Compilation failure
Erro ao compilar o pacote "ACBr_DFeComum.dpk".

 

 

O que são esses comentários nas linhas sublinhadas?

 

 

procedure TDFeHttpIndy.ConfigurarHTTP(const AURL, ASoapAction: String;  const AMimeType: String);
begin
  with FpDFeSSL do
  begin
    if ProxyHost <> '' then
    begin
      FIndyReqResp.Proxy := ProxyHost + ':' + ProxyPort;
      FIndyReqResp.UserName := ProxyUser;
      FIndyReqResp.Password := ProxyPass;
    end;

    FIndyReqResp.ConnectTimeout := TimeOut;
<<<<<<< .mine
//    FIndyReqResp.SendTimeout    := TimeOut;
=======
  {$IF CompilerVersion >= 33}
    //NOTA: Não existe a propriedade SendTimeout em Soap.SOAPHTTPTrans (Delphi 10.3.1)
    //No Delphi 10.3 SendTimeout = ReceiveTimeout
    FIndyReqResp.ReceiveTimeout := TimeOut;
  {$ELSE}
    FIndyReqResp.SendTimeout    := TimeOut;
>>>>>>> .r17452
    FIndyReqResp.ReceiveTimeout := TimeOut;
  {$IFEND}
  end;

  FMimeType := AMimeType;

//  FIndyReqResp.OnBeforePost := OnBeforePost;
  FIndyReqResp.UseUTF8InHeader := True;
  FIndyReqResp.SoapAction := ASoapAction;
  FIndyReqResp.URL := AURL;
end;

 

  • Moderadores
  • Solution
Postado
2 minutos atrás, bochnia disse:

O que são esses comentários nas linhas sublinhadas?

São conflitos de atualização que o Tortoise SVN insere ao atualizar os fontes, quando havia alterações locais feitas na sua cópia dos fontes com as alterações aplicadas no repositório.

Você pode analisar e resolver as diferenças pela função "Resolve" no menu to Tortoise SVN.

  • Curtir 1
Equipe ACBr BigWings
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

 

 

  • Este tópico foi criado há 2025 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.
Visitante
Este tópico está agora fechado para novas respostas
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.

The popup will be closed in 10 segundos...
The popup will be closed in 10 segundos...